LEARNING LAB: (7:30 - 9:00) (Suggested Donation 5$)

** WIRE MONKEY MACHINES:

Saliq Savage of Wire Monkey Dance will present live video machines that examine the interface of web technology and our every day lives. As practically everyone uses a handy of one sort or another to gather information and communicate, the interface with the machine becomes ever more important. Wire Monkey Machines are different in that they require the audience/participant to move beyond the brain/finger-tap for control and turn inward to the body to access movement for control of the interface and their expression. This is an opportunity to experiment with some machines that will be part of an exhibit at A.P.E. Window in April 2011.

Saliq Savage co-directs Wire Monkey Dance company. He is a Certified Practitioner and Teacher of Body-Mind Centering® and Teaches Contact Improvisation. He maintains a private body-work practice working developmentally with Infants, children and adults.

Special Guest Performance : Manavi

Manavi is a troupe of dancers and musicians based in Northampton, MA. Featuring three captivating and unique belly dancers - Felicia Malachite, Sugati and Sahina, Manavi plays both original music and classic Middle Eastern songs. Musicians include Amanda Turk, Stephen Malachite, Sharon Arslanian, Chris Phillips, Jake Sirois and the beautiful voice of Megan Shackelford. Whether its the mystical sounds of cello and ney, or the passionate rhythms of dumbek, riq, and frame drums, Manavi creates a sound charged with spirit and delight which is not to be missed!
